Nest Mini playing a different artist’s music

taettokkii
Community Member

I can’t make my nest mini to play the correct artist’s song via spotify anymore unless I manually connect via bluetooth. I always just say “hey google, play bts”, and it’ll play bts (the kpop group) songs. Now every time I say the same phrase, it’ll play another artist which is also named bts on spotify. I already blocked the wrong artist on spotify and nest mini will just respond with “something went wrong, when you’re ready give it another try”. How can I make it play the correct artist’s song without having to manually connect via bluetooth? Sometimes I don’t have my phone with me and it’s just convenient to just say the phrase to the device (w/c is what it’s meant to do).

Try these troubleshooting steps:

 

  • Open the Google Home app > Settings > Music > Choose “No default provider.”
  • Unlink your Spotify account > Force close the Google Home app.
  • Unplug and plug back in your Google Nest Mini device from the power outlet for a minute.
  • Open the Google Home app and link your Spotify account again.
  • Command your Google Nest Mini to play BTS.
